Description

"There are few sources of objective, scientifically sound advice for people who could benefit from the use of medicinal marijuana. Most books about marijuana and medicine simply attempt to promote the views of advocates or opponents. To fill the gap between these extremes, authors Alison Mack and Janet Joy have extracted critical findings from a recent Institute of Medicine study on this important issue, interpreting them for a general audience.". "Marijuana as Medicine? provides patients - and the people who care for them - with a foundation for making decisions about their own health care. Empowering, enlightening, and objective, it will be a valuable tool for making informed health care decisions."--BOOK JACKET.
